Sony Portapak

Nam June Paik is regarded as the first buyer of the Sony Portapak, the first portable video recorder. The first video work, which has not survived, is a recording of Pope Paul VI’s visit to New York on October 4, 1965, which is shown on the same evening at Café au GoGo. In 1986, Siegfried Zielinski demonstrated that Paik actually must have used the Sony CV-2000/TCV-2010 video camera, a combination of recorder, camera, and monitor, because the Portapak was in fact first introduced to the US market in 1967.
